Essential Features of Gasoline Trucks
When considering a gasoline truck for sale in Equatorial Guinea, evaluating key features can guide prospective buyers towards making informed decisions.
Key Specifications
- Engine Power: Look for an optimal engine size that balances power with fuel efficiency.
- Tank Capacity: The cab’s capacity should align with the expected load to be transported.
- Safety Features: Essential safety provisions, such as anti-lock braking systems, roll stability control, and spill containment systems, ensure both driver safety and compliance with environmental regulations.
- Durability: Look for trucks constructed from robust materials designed to withstand the local climate and terrain.

Buying a Gasoline Truck in Equatorial Guinea
Purchasing a gasoline truck requires careful consideration and planning. Here are some crucial steps to ensure a wise investment.
Steps to Make the Right Purchase
- Conduct Market Research – Evaluate various sellers and manufacturers, focusing on customer reviews, warranties, and post-purchase support.
- Assess Your Needs – Determine what your specific requirements are regarding size, capacity, and functionality.
- Visit Showrooms – Whenever possible, inspect the vehicle physically. Check for features, test the handling, and inquire about additional options or accessories.
- Get a Quotation – Request quotes from multiple sources. This will provide you with a broad perspective on market pricing and available features.
- Analyze Total Ownership Cost – Consider not just the purchase price but also maintenance, insurance, and fuel costs over the vehicle’s expected lifetime.
- Warranty and After-sales Service – Look for comprehensive warranties and reliable service options from the manufacturer, ensuring you aren’t left vulnerable to unexpected repairs.
Financing Options
When considering a gasoline truck for sale in Equatorial Guinea, it’s imperative to explore financing options. The financial aspect could directly impact cash flow and overall business health.
Financing Methods
- Loans from Banks or Financial Institutions: Often competitive, traditional loans can help manage expenses effectively, although they may require collateral.
- Leasing Agreements: Leasing can give businesses access to new vehicles without a significant upfront cost, perfect for adapting to fluctuating needs.
